Legal & General Group Plc decreased its position in shares of Kinder Morgan, Inc. (NYSE:KMI - Free Report) by 2.0%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 15,561,768 shares of the pipeline company's stock after selling 317,130 shares during the period. Legal & General Group Plc owned approximately 0.70% of Kinder Morgan worth $427,793,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Kinder Morgan (NYSE:KMI -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 22nd. The pipeline company reported $0.48 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.38 by $0.10. Kinder Morgan had a return on equity of 9.90% and a net margin of 18.92%.The firm had revenue of $4.83 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$4.55 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.34 earnings per share.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 13.8% on a year-over-year basis. Kinder Morgan has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.360-1.360 EPS. Equities research analysts forecast that Kinder Morgan, Inc. will post 1.49 EPS for the current year.

Kinder Morgan Increases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, May 15th. Stockholders of record on Monday, May 4th were paid a dividend of $0.2975 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, May 4th. This is a positive change from Kinder Morgan's previous quarterly dividend of $0.29. This represents a $1.19 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.5%. Kinder Morgan's payout ratio is 79.87%.

About Kinder Morgan

(Free Report)

Kinder Morgan NYSE: KMI is a large energy infrastructure company that owns and operates an extensive network of pipelines and terminals across North America. Its core activities center on the transportation, storage and handling of energy products, including natural gas, natural gas liquids (NGLs), crude oil, refined petroleum products and carbon dioxide. The company's assets include long-haul and gathering pipelines, storage facilities, and multi-modal terminals that serve producers, refiners, utilities and industrial customers.

Kinder Morgan's operations deliver midstream services such as pipeline transportation, terminaling, storage and related logistics and maintenance.
